SPI Pharma is a supplier of functional excipients, antacid actives and drug-delivery technologies to the pharmaceutical and nutritional industries, describing its objective as to "engineer functional materials that enable customers to solve formulation problems, achieve differentiation and gain speed to market". Its portfolio includes mannitols, taste-masked actives, tartaric acid pellets, lubricants, sugars, calcium carbonate, antacid actives (aluminium and magnesium compounds), digestive-aid actives, mineral-supplement ingredients and vaccine adjuvants. The company is owned by Associated British Foods and is part of the ABF Ingredients (ABFI) division.
